Explanation

"Loss of voice" refers to a condition where a person is unable to speak or has difficulty speaking. This can be due to strain or damage to the vocal cords, which are the parts of the throat that produce sound. It can also be caused by a cold, flu, or other illness that affects the throat. The person may sound hoarse, whispery, or may not be able to make any sound at all.
